Kawhi Leonard’s career high. When he plays at this level, the Clippers are not the same, that much is obvious. The two-time Finals MVP was outstanding, from start to finish. He had 25 points at halftime, before adding 26 points in the third quarter alone! He would come back in the final quarter to score four short points to finish with a career-high 55 points. With 11 rebounds, 5 steals and 3 blocks. Even stronger, his percentage: 17/26 on shots and 16/17 on free throws. Huge, simply, and his rating confirms it: 63!
